Genesis Are Reuniting with Last Domino Tour

5th March 2020 | Category: Concerts

The prog rock legendary band Genesis have announced they are returning to the stage together one more time. Phil Collins, Tony Banks and Mike Rutherford, will be going on a tour taking place later in 2020.

The tour will include a series of dates across the UK.

The outing begins in Dublin on November 16th. There’ll also be stops in London, Liverpool, Leeds, Birmingham, Belfast, Manchester, Glasgow and Newcastle.

Before the official announcement was made, the band had posted a hint on their Instagram page, reading: “And then there were three”.

In 2007, the band celebrated the 40th anniversary of their formation at Charterhouse School in Surrey. That year, with the Turn It On Again tour, Phil Collins bid the band’s final farewell.

However, the band frontman is on board to hit the stage again.

Collins’ 18-year-old son Nicholas will be joining the trio on the drums. His longstanding associate Daryl Stuermer will be on guitar and bass.

Over the years Collins’ health has deteriorated due to nerve damage he sustained in his back while performing. This means he is unable to play the drums to his full ability. It’s also the main reason why his son is accompanying the band on their reunion tour.

Collins commented on his son’s involvement.

“For me it wasn’t a deal breaker, but… it was a problem we had to overcome, with me not playing,” he said. Despite this, he promised he’ll do his best to still play “some bits on the tour.”

Rutherford said: “It feels great, it feels the right time, we’re looking forward to doing it. A lot of our contemporaries have been playing a lot – we’ve done two shows in the UK in the last 28 years.”
